MOHAMMAD ABDUS SALAM

"The water of Zam Zam is a symbol of endless hope and purity. Our foundation strives to be a source of life-changing relief for the thirstiest souls on Earth."

Inspired by a lifelong dedication to community upliftment, MOHAMMAD ABDUS SALAM established the Zam Zam Welfare Foundation Bangladesh in 2012 to address deep structural inequalities, focus on localized crisis prevention, and offer clean water and nutritional support to remote geographies.

Under his visionary guidance, the foundation expanded from a regional food shelter into an international humanitarian beacon operating complex educational systems, high-efficiency water treatment facilities, and rapid emergency logistics wings.

We don’t believe in temporary band-aid measures. When we drill a well, we ensure it’s filtered, solar-pumped, and legally owned by areawise female cooperatives to avoid asset capturing by local elites. When we enroll an orphan child, we sponsor them until they secure a fully certified university degree or custom tech vocational employment.
